Jonesboro TX, population 200, began as a sawmill and gristmil built by two brothers, William L. and David Jones. After the Civil War, settlers came to the area and the community was reffered to as Jones Mill. The name was changed to Jonesboro in 1877. 

By the 1890s, the town had as many as 700 people, yet in 1911 the Stephenville, North and South Texas Railway bypassed Jonesboro and its population dwindled. This occured again in the 1930s, when the construction of Highway 36 drew people away.
